Tangail, Gaibandha, Panchagarh road accidents kill four


Four persons were killed in separate road accidents in Tangail, Gaibandha and Panchagarh districts on Saturday, report agencies.
In Tangail, a woman and his son were killed being hit by a bus in Jhawaile area under Gopalpur upazila of the district on Saturday.
The deceased were identified as China Begum, 48, wife of late Kamruzzaman Tota, and her son Sakib Miah, 19, of Mouza Dakuri village under Gopalpur upazila of the district.
The accident occurred when Sakib Miah was going to Gopalpur upazila headquarters riding a motorcycle with his mother and collided head-on with a bus coming from the opposite direction in the area around 8am on Saturday morning. They died on the spot, officer-in-charge (OC) of Gopalpur Police Station Emdadul Islam Taiyab said.
Police recovered the bodies from the spot and seized the bus but its driver and helper managed to escape, the OC added.
In Gaibandha, a headmaster of a school was crushed to death under the wheels of a truck on Dinajpur-Gobindaganj highway at Kata area in Gaibandha district Saturday.
The deceased, Lutfor Rahman, 55, was the headmaster of Bairagihat Govt Primary School.
According to his family, he was on his way to Gobindaganj's market to buy groceries for his son's wedding reception programme.
According to locals, the speedy truck ran over his motorcycle and fled the scene, leaving him dead on the spot.
In Panchagarh, a bus driver was killed in a road accident on the Debiganj-Domar highway in Debiganj upazila of the district on Saturday morning.
The deceased was identified as Sumon Islam, 28, son of Hasibul Islam, a resident of Pamuli village of the upazila.
A case was filed in this connection.
